Explain the various types of tournaments.

- Knock-out Tournament: In this tournament, a team that loses once is automatically eliminated and will not be able to play again. The tournament will have a total of n − 1 matches, which is the number of participating teams minus one. For example, if 12 teams compete, the total number of matches is 12 − 1 = 11.
- League Tournament: In this tournament, each side will play one match against each other. The total number of matches in a single league tournament should equal `(n(n-1))/2` e.g., if 10 teams are competing, the total number of matches to be played shall be:
`(n(n-1))/2 = (10(10-1))/2 = (10(9))/2 = 90/2` = 45 Matches
(Small ‘n’ stands for total number of teams participating in the tournament.) - Combination Tournament: This type of tournament usually takes place when a large number of teams from different locations compete in a specific game. Teams in the same group compete for the title of champion through knockout or league play.
- Challenge Tournament: There are two types of challenge tournaments:
- The Ladder Tournament.
- The Pyramid Tournament. Challenge tournaments typically involve single and dual games, such as badminton and tennis.
- Tournaments can be held for any duration without a set timetable. Players construct their own arrangements and play matches with each other.
